predict
US /prɪˈdɪkt/
UK /prɪˈdɪkt/

动词
1.
预测, 预言
state or estimate that a specified thing will happen in the future or will be a consequence of something
示例:
•
It's difficult to predict the outcome of the election.
很难预测选举结果。
•
Scientists can predict earthquakes with some accuracy.
科学家可以相对准确地预测地震。
